Family fun in St. George

St. George is the largest city in southwestern Utah and offers a variety of activities for every age. Stunning hiking rails abundant and present hikes of any difficulty, with destinations of waterfalls and swimming holes for the kids to cool off in.

If climbing rocks is something your kids enjoy, check out Pioneer Park and let their imaginations run wild as they climb, jump, and explore the wild elevation and hidden caves. They can also test their bravery by attempting to hike through The St. George Narrows, a small slot canyon that appears impossible to get through. 

After all that hiking, you’ll be ready to relax at the beautiful Town Square Park, offering a an interactive water playground and plenty of shaded areas to relax or even have a picnic lunch.

Set aside one of your days to spend at Thunder Junction Park, an all-abilities seven-acre park that everyone can enjoy. With a dinosaur theme complete with waterfalls, splash pads, play structures and even a train, you can spend the whole day laughing, playing, and exploring.

Speaking of dinosaurs, the real-life dinosaur tracks at the Dinosaur Discovery Site and the Warner Valley Dinosaur Track Site will transport you to a different time when these amazing creatures roamed the earth, leaving clues by way of prints and fossils into how they lived their lives. Kids can help dig for fossils or learn about all things prehistoric in the museum.
